Relativistic Kinetic Energy
At high speeds, the classical KE formula (0.5mv^2) underestimates the true kinetic energy.
Formula
KE = (gamma - 1) * m0 * c^2
This approaches 0.5 m0 v^2 for v much less than c, and grows without bound as v approaches c.
Example Calculation
1 kg at 0.9c.
- 01gamma = 2.294
- 02KE = (2.294 - 1) * 1 * (2.998e8)^2
- 03KE = 1.294 * 8.988e16
- 04KE = 1.163e17 J
- 05Classical: 0.5 * 1 * (2.698e8)^2 = 3.640e16 J
- 06Relativistic is 3.2x larger
